BOX OFFICE: IRON MAN 3 Is The Top Grossing Movie Of 2013

Probably not much of a surprise, but the Marvel threequel sits comfortably at the top of the 10 highest grossing movies of 2013 list, with Man Of Steel taking fourth place behind Despicable Me 2 and The Hunger Games: Catching Fire. Click on for the list in full.

Some of you CBMers feel 2013 wasn't a particularly good year for our beloved comic book films, and obviously in terms of overall quality that's a debate worth having...but one thing is for sure, they certainly made quite a bit of coin! The Times has released a list of the top 10 highest grossing films of 2013, and with a whopping $1,215,439,994 worldwide box office gross, Iron Man 3 takes the top spot. The rest of the list is, predictably enough, made up of big budget sci-fi/action movies and animated adventures. At 2 there's Despicable Me 2, 3) The Hunger Games: Catching Fire, 4) Man of Steel, 5) Monsters University, 6) Gravity, 7) Fast & Furious 6, 8) Oz the Great and Powerful, 9) Star Trek Into Darkness and at 10 we have World War Z.

NOTE: Although Iron Man 3 is sure to be safe at the top, the likes of Thor: The Dark World and The Hobbit: The Desolation Of Smaug will likely impact this list in some way come December 31st, so we'll have an update around then.
